Compensation And Early Restitution Tops The Priority List of An Injury Lawyer In Oakville

While opting for legal counsel and prompt restitution in the wake of an accident, you must remember that the city entails a provision or stature for limitations related to claim filing. Usually, it's two years in these cases. In case, you exceed the deadline, you might lose your very right to pursue a case and file a lawsuit. Hence, the longer you procrastinate, the more difficult it will be to win a case and obtain a fair compensation for the financial loss and physical pain. Faulty products

Now, how often have you heard or seen brand new mobile phones com busting while charging or exploding just after coming out of the packet? It's pretty frequent right? You need to know that you can sue the manufacturer of that product for two things. First is for making such faulty and malfunctioning product. Second is for not mentioning clearly or just avoiding the usage part. There should be clear instructions and warnings if a product is that vulnerable to combustion. It results in serious explosions and electrocutions, causing dangerous burns and scarring.
